Loyalty is an essential fabric woven deep into the Ball Family.
So the fact that the Bulls never gave up hope that Lonzo Ball would return from an experimental left knee surgery that cost him two-plus seasons, resonated with the point guard.
He was down and the Bulls stood by him.
Ball figured last week he could return the favor.
That’s when the veteran agreed to a hometown discount to stay with the Bulls, signing a two-year, $20 million extension with the second year being a team option.
